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 6-K, dated August 9, 2006, serves as a notice of upcoming financial reporting for Copa Holdings, S.A. The company operates as a leading Latin American provider of passenger and cargo services through its subsidiaries, Copa Airlines and AeroRepublica. Copa Airlines operates 110 daily flights to 34 destinations across 20 countries, while AeroRepublica serves as the second-largest domestic carrier in Colombia.

Guidance, Outlook, and Management Commentary
Management has scheduled the release of Second Quarter 2006 financial results for August 16, 2006, before U.S. markets open. A conference call and webcast are scheduled for 11:00 a.m. U.S. EDT on the same date. Speakers will include CEO Pedro Heilbron and CFO Victor Vial.
